    Now with all that being said, here's my Top 10 additions of 2019:

    10) 2012-13 Panini Prime Namesakes /75 Letter "T" - Jhonas Enroth




    It may not look like much, but the Autographed Letter T in this nameplate was the final letter I needed to finish off this Enroth nameplate from Panini Prime. After being outbid or sniped for years, this one finally became availible for me to finally put this nameplate to bed. Feels good man.

    9) Upper Deck 300 Win Club Terry Sawchuk


    I picked this up at the Spring Expo. So glad I was able to cross this off my 300 Win Club Want list. Aside from the Belfour, the Sawchuk is probably the most saught after card in the ongoing 300 Win Club set. They don't come up for sale too often, so I'm glad I was able to add this card to my collection. A nice piece of Terry's stick, too!

    8) 2011-12 Dominion Peerless Patches Dual Miller/Enroth /15


    I'm not a big fan of booklet cards to be honest, but this one is the exception to that rule. This beautiful card features two awesome patches from Ryan Miller and Jhonas Enroth. I was eyeing one of these for a long time on eBay, but the price tag was way too overpriced for what I was willing to pay. Sure enough, another copy became availible and I was able to win this at auction. Funny enough, when I attended the Spring expo not too long after getting this card in hand, I saw another copy of this card at someone's table. It was also very overpriced in my opinion, so I am glad I was able to snag a copy for my collection when I did.

    7) 2018-19 SeReal KHL 11th Season Premium Jersey /10 - Jhonas Enroth


    As soon as I saw the checklist for the 18-19 SeReal KHL 11th Season Premium, this card jumped out to me immediately. I just knew I had to have it. This card features a piece of Enroth's 2018 Winter Ice Break game jersey when Dinamo Minsk faced off against Dynamo Riga in the great outdoors for the KHL's second ever outdoor game. The picture used on the card was taken during that game, which is also a nice touch.

    6) 2008-09 ITG Ultimate Memorabilia Complete Package Silver Jacques Plante /9


    Picked this card up at the expo as well. This card just jumped out to me when flipping through a random bin and I just knew I had to have it. Just a beautiful looking card with 4 pieces of vintage memorabilia, limited to 9 copies. Incredible piece for my goalie collection.

    5) 2013 Tre Kronor Team Issued Oversized Card - Jhonas Enroth


    It's not everyday that you find cards you didn't know existed. I was browsing Tradera one night when I saw this oversized 5x9 Tre Kronor (Three Crowns) team Sweden team issued card come up for sale out of Germany of all places. It is the correct size when looking at other team Sweden stuff, but I hadn't seen this copy before. I'd like to say I won it with ease, but there was an intense bidding war for this card during the final morning. I'm glad I was able to add this unique piece to the collection.

    4) 2012-13 ITG Superlative Past, Present And Future Enroth/ Miller/ Hasek /9 and 1/1



    These next two additions I'll count in one spot. They both came from a single deal with another Enroth collector who to my surprise made these availible to me out of the blue. I had onlt intended to make a deal for the Silver /9 (Left), but this generous collector made the Gold 1/1 (Right) availible to me as well. I never thought I'd add these cards to my collection, so these two were huge.

    3) 2018-19 SeReal KHL Exclusive Collection Part 2 - KHL Goaltenders Printing Plate 1/1 - Jhonas Enroth


    Printing plates have been around in this hobby for a long time now. I think they've lost their initial appeal over the years, but I've always loved picking them up when I can and this one is no exception. This KHL Goaltenders Insert Printing Plate marks my very first KHL 1/1 in my Enroth collection. Considering the intense competition for Enroth's KHL cards, crossing 1 of the 4 printing plates off my list was a big accomplishment for this collection of mine.

    2) 2011-12 Score Black Ice - Jhonas Enroth


    I picked this one up at the beginning of 2019 and it has been one of my most elusive additions of this year. The Score Black Ice parallels are very saught after by player collectors everywhere. These parallels might not look like much, but the black border on these 11-12 Score cards really stands out from the rest and is probably one of my favourite parallels in my collection. It's simple but it works. I had to do a double-take when I saw this card pop up on COMC back in January.

    1) 2011-12 ITG Between The Pipes Dual Autograph Enroth/ Barrasso /5



    If you frequent my Enroth collection threads online, then this card needs no introduction (Check our my "White. Whale." blog post for more). This White Whale of a card appeared on eBay not too long ago, and this was one I was not going to let go. A true white whale in every sense of the word. With a print run of just 5 copies, I knew of (at least) 3 copies that had previously surfaced and were locked away in Tom Barrasso collections. With the known competition for Barrasso collectors over the years, I wasn't sure if I'd ever find this card, but sure enough I finally did.
